
EU Applications
Following the UK’s exit from the European Union, many EU, EEA and Swiss citizens, and their family members, need to secure their status in the UK through specific immigration routes. The most common of these are the EU Settlement Scheme and Frontier Worker permits.
The EU Settlement Scheme allows eligible applicants to obtain settled or pre-settled status, confirming their right to live and work in the UK. In some cases, late applications are permitted, but these must be carefully explained and supported. Frontier Worker permits are available for EU citizens who continue to work in the UK while living in another country.
